Not belonging to an original toolkit, but a nice period correct* addition: an 15-17 bent ring spanner. Super handy if you need to replace that starter motor, it's about the only way to get the top bolt out with a full engine bay.

As with original ring spanners it has shiny chromed ends, and it uses the 'No' with a small line under the zero.

* it does say GERMANY, and not W-GERMANY, which has me wondering. Could it be post unification but made with older tooling that was modified to take out the "W-" part?
I just picked up a very similar wrench from ebay for $9, plus 48 state shipping of course. It's a 14-17mm not the 15-17mm posted above, but does say W. Germany. Hard to see in the photo but it does have the underlined o in No.
